At just 14 years old, Cristiano Ronaldo Jr is already commanding attention across the football world. Recently called up to Portugal’s U15 national team for an international tournament in Croatia, the young forward made his debut in a 4–1 win over Japan, coming off the bench to mark his first international steps.
But according to The Sun, over 16 top European clubs were in attendance—not just to watch the match, but to closely observe the son of CR7. The goal? Not to miss out on the next big thing, as many did when Cristiano Sr was rising through the ranks two decades ago.
Still Young, But Already a Star Name
Cristiano Jr is far from the finished product, but with such a famous name and growing expectations, his development will be heavily scrutinized. The pressure is immense, but so is the intrigue: can he follow in his father’s footsteps?
